He uses drawing, printmaking, painting, photography, sculpture, film and installation as means to critically question and represent contemporary events. His narrative reflects on the division between nature and culture, the spectacle as a mediator of society and the imprint of the Anthropocene on our planet.
He has a degree in Visual Arts (ENAP-UNAM) and a Master in Artistic Practice (UPV Valencia, Spain) in both cases with Honorable Mention. He studied at the University Center for Cinematographic Studies (CUEC-UNAM). He was a beneficiary of the Scholarship Program for Studies Abroad (FONCA 2008) and on two occasions the Artistic Residencies Program (FONCA 2010 and 2013). He received support from the Jumex Foundation for postgraduate studies (2009). He received Honorable Mention in the Youth Award (INJUVE 2011) and support for Project Development for the documentary Juan Perros (IMCINE 2014).
Artist in residence: Zanate Residency in Colima, Mexico (2020), Art Cube Artist Studios in Jerusalem, Israel (2017), International Studio and Curatorial Program ISCP in New York (FONCA 2010), Art Omi in New York (2013), Residency Unlimited in New York (FONCA, 2014) and Flux Factory in New York (2014).

He has participated in several exhibitions in Mexico, the USA, Argentina, Spain, Italy, the Netherlands, Belgium, Germany, Poland, Chile and Colombia. In collaboration with Santiago Robles he made: “These Ruinas Que Ven” Palacio de la Autonomía UNAM, Mexico (2022). “Happy Milpa” Callejón de Arte, Mexico (2021).
Filmography: JUAN PERROS is his First Film. BEST DOCUMENTARY SHORT FILM 14FICM Morelia International Film Festival, 2016. BEST FIRST FEATURE International Festival of Mexico City DocsMx, 2017. INTERNATIONAL PREMIERE 56 SEMAINE DE LA CRITIQUE of the Cannes Festival, 2017. HONORABLE MENTION at ZANATE Mexican Documentary Film Festival 2018.
Teaching Experience: 2019 to date Drawing Professor at the EScine Film School. 2015: Guest Professor at John Jay College of New York. 2012: Subject Professor in the Postgraduate in Arts at the Academy of San Carlos FAD UNAM. Subject: Drawing, Look and Image.
